Jeff Porter 2021Magic Lite has announced the appointment of Jeff Porter to the position of Chief Operating Officer.

Porter has spent over 30 years in the North American electrical and lighting manufacturing and distribution industry, helping numerous companies build innovative product portfolios and channel strategies to ensure profitable growth. His experience and leadership qualities facilitated the advancement of several top companies, including NSi Industries, NII Northern International, Intermatic and Siemens to name a few.

“As we look ahead through 2021, we see significant opportunity for our company to play a key role in providing specialty lighting solutions that address our changing world,” says Tom Penton, Founder and President of Magic Lite. “Jeff’s insight into the needs of our industry and customer base will allow us to build on our track record of consistently delivering highly targeted products and superior service programs that best support our customers.”

“My philosophy is that success is driven by the success of our customers,” says Porter. “Tom and the team at Magic Lite have always had a strong commitment to their channel partners – and I’m excited to help expand our market footprint while striving to exceed customer expectations to ensure we continue to deliver on this promise.”
